Nestled in the heart of the ever-popular Great Baddow Conservation Area, this charming cottage is perfectly positioned to enjoy a peaceful setting while remaining within easy reach of an excellent range of local amenities.
Great Baddow is one of Chelmsford's most sought-after locations, offering a selection of highly regarded primary and secondary schools, a variety of independent shops, cafés, restaurants and takeaways, together with regular bus services providing convenient access to Chelmsford city centre and the surrounding areas.
For commuters, the property benefits from excellent access to the A12, while Chelmsford railway station offers frequent services to London Liverpool Street in as little as 34 minutes, making it ideal for those travelling into the capital.
Chelmsford itself boasts an extensive range of shopping and leisure facilities, including the popular Bond Street retail and dining destination, two shopping centres, an abundance of restaurants, cafés, bars and entertainment venues, together with attractions such as Riverside Leisure Centre and Ice Rink.
